Part 2: How to Conduct the Activity (Guide for Activity Facilitator)
Dear Facilitator,
This session is about helping students hear how AI can remix and reimagine their world.
- Introduce the Theme 🎙️
- Write on the board: “Our voices, our sounds, our stories — reimagined with AI.”
- Say: “AI can turn simple sounds into new forms of music and expression. Today, we’ll learn how prompts shape sound, just as they shape answers.”
- Start Simple 🌱
- Ask students to imagine a sound from their daily life (temple bell, traffic signal, rain on rooftops).
- Begin with a broad prompt:
“Generate an AI audio track inspired by the sounds of my city.”
- Refine the Prompts Together 🌿
- Encourage them to specify instruments, mood, or purpose.
- Examples:
- “Generate a calm background track inspired by the sound of temple bells in the morning.”
- “Create an energetic audio track inspired by Nagpur’s market sounds with a fusion of drums and claps.”
- “Remix the sound of monsoon rain into a meditation track.”
- Reflection After Each Try 🌸
- Ask: “What changed when we added detail?”
- “Which version feels closer to our imagination?”
- Closing the Activity 🌼
- Share: “Sound has always been central to Indian culture — from Vedic mantras to folk songs. Today, you saw how AI can carry that heritage forward in new forms. The clearer our prompts, the closer the sound matches our vision.”
- Feedback Form ✍️
- Ask students to write one line on what sound from their childhood they’d like to reimagine with AI.
